Can I use any tablet with my Ring Doorbell?
While many tablets are compatible with the Ring Doorbell, not all tablets are created equal. The Ring app is available for both iOS and Android devices, so you’ll want to make sure your tablet is running one of these operating systems. Additionally, the Ring app requires a minimum amount of RAM and processor speed to run smoothly, so older or lower-end tablets may not be compatible. It’s also worth noting that some tablets, like the Kindle Fire, may have limited access to the Google Play Store or Apple App Store, which could affect your ability to download and update the Ring app.
If you’re unsure whether your tablet is compatible with your Ring Doorbell, you can check the Ring website for a list of supported devices or contact Ring customer support directly. They’ll be able to advise you on whether your tablet is compatible and provide troubleshooting tips if you’re experiencing any issues. In general, it’s a good idea to opt for a tablet from a reputable manufacturer that runs a recent version of iOS or Android, as these will be more likely to support the Ring app and receive regular software updates.
Do I need a tablet to use my Ring Doorbell?
No, you don’t necessarily need a tablet to use your Ring Doorbell. The Ring app is available for download on both smartphones and tablets, so you can use your phone to view live footage, receive notifications, and communicate with visitors. Many people prefer to use their phone to monitor their Ring Doorbell, as it’s often more convenient and portable than a tablet. However, using a tablet can provide a larger and more immersive viewing experience, which can be beneficial if you want to keep an eye on your front door from a distance.
If you do decide to use a tablet with your Ring Doorbell, you’ll want to place it in a convenient location where you can easily view the live footage and receive notifications. Some people like to place their tablet near their front door, while others prefer to keep it in a home office or living room. Ultimately, the choice of whether to use a phone or tablet with your Ring Doorbell comes down to personal preference and your specific needs. If you’re looking for a more portable solution, a phone may be the way to go – but if you want a larger display and a more immersive viewing experience, a tablet could be the better choice.

Can I use multiple tablets with my Ring Doorbell?
Yes, you can use multiple tablets with your Ring Doorbell. In fact, one of the benefits of the Ring system is that it allows you to connect multiple devices to a single account, so you can view live footage and receive notifications on multiple tablets or phones. This can be convenient if you want to keep an eye on your front door from multiple locations, or if you have multiple family members who want to be able to monitor the doorbell.
To use multiple tablets with your Ring Doorbell, you’ll simply need to download and install the Ring app on each device, and then log in to your Ring account. Once you’ve logged in, you’ll be able to view live footage and receive notifications on each tablet, just as you would on a single device. You can also customize your notification settings and adjust the motion detection sensitivity for each device separately, which can be useful if you have different preferences for different locations.
